HTC's new phone, the One M7, for all the amazing things it does, has a shockingly poor battery life. Most of the smart phones today suffer from poor battery life what with their HD screens and power hogging processors and lot of users complain that they don't last even for a single day. Users upgrading from the previous generation 'dumb' devices are pretty disappointed with the battery life of HTC One. The M7's predecessor One X was criticized for its smaller battery and people were expecting bigger and better battery from HTC One M7 this time around.

How to improve battery life of HTC One M7
If you think your device does last only for a few hours then here are some points to improve your battery backup of your device.
HTC One Power Saver
HTC has built in its own stock battery saver app. You can find it in Settings >> Power >> Power Saver. Just turn it on and it will optimize your usage to improve the battery life of your phone.Display screen and brightness
Turn off the auto brightness and try to keep it as low as you can probably bear. Your huge HD display screen can easily use up 30-40% of your battery and that's the reason why you should give utmost importance to your display brightness. HTC M7 has the sharpest display in the world with 469 ppi and powering such vibrant display will definitely take a toll on your device in terms of battery consumption.Screen lock/ Sleep
Some of you might not be in the habit of locking your device using the auto lock feature. It is recommended to keep auto screen lock to 30 seconds. This means after the period of 30 seconds, your phone will get locked or be put to sleep to save power.
Turn off data & Auto Sync
Leaving your phone idle with 3G or LTE on is the best way to drain your battery of your HTC One M7. To avoid this you could use some power management apps like Juice Defender, which save your battery by managing enable-disable of the data on their own.Auto Sync-Push notification
Apps like Whatsapp, Hike, gTalk and Facebook use push notifications to deliver your messages as soon as they are sent to you which consumes a lot of power as your phone's listening services are always on. Find out the application using push notifications and change the setting from an individual app. Auto sync is another crucial factor affecting your battery life as it is used to fetch your emails from the configured addresses. Always turn off the data when not in the use.
Taking good care of your battery
HTC One comes with standard Li-Po 2300 battery and along with the smartphones, the batteries in them are getting smarter too. Newer batteries adjust themselves according to the usage of an individual.Always charge of phone when it gets to the level of 15-20%. Avoid repetitive charging and once plugged in, try to charge complete battery. Try not to use heavy features such as camera, LTE while the phone is getting charged.
Avoid fully Discharge frequently
If your friend ever suggested to to discharge your battery completely, Ignore him. This suggestion helps for old nickel batteries and the concept of battery memory doesn’t apply to lithium batteries. Fully discharging your lithium battery frequently can actually be quite harmful to your battery’s health. It can possibly make it completely unusable and reduces it's life.
